
When will we ever get enough of basics? They’re great for those of us who don’t have the budget to get that huge wardrobe we all dream of and go great with everything. A closet of substantial basic pieces could in fact, give you several variations and outfit looks.
Here, we cover one of our favourite basics — and one that ALL of us have — the basic t-shirt. They’re a unisex piece that can be paired with anything, be it shorts, skirts, jeans, or even worn over a dress. Here, we’ve listed the coolest ways to wear a tee, inspired by street style stars.
1. Go Feminine
Catching fashion blogger Chriselle Lim in a skirt is quite a rarity. But nonetheless, this self-proclaimed pants/trousers person looked effortlessly stylish and feminine in this ensemble. She pairs a basic white tee with a pleated maxi skirt and an uber cosy-looking long cardigan. We love how she kept all the colours in this look muted for a chill walk-in-the-park type getup.
2. Stick To Monochromes
One thing to learn from Youtuber Jenn Im’s outfit: Monochromatic looks never fail. She wears her own brand T-shirt with checked trousers and to-die-for chunky platform boots. We’re digging the grunge girl look she was going for with this getup, from cuffing her trousers and t-shirt to her black beanie and even the simple black band bracelet. Love.

3. Rock It With Pops Of Colour
We can count on Korean It girl, Irene Kim to make almost any outfit look like a 10. Here, she wears a mainly black ensemble — which makes her orange puffer coat, t-shirt graphic and purple hair pop. This gives a refreshing element to her look and is actually really easy to recreate.
4. Take It Semi-Casual
Singapore’s very own style influencer Yoyo Cao displays her own take on the basic Tee. She elevates the t-shirt from causal to semi-casual by simply pairing it with chic wide-leg trousers.
Some tips when recreating this outfit – opt for pants with structure for a formal look, and if you want to take the outfit up a notch, pair with heels and a matching blazer.
5. Wear It As A Statement
Italian fashion girl Chiara Ferragni made her statement-making Dior t-shirt the main accent piece of her outfit — and we’re obsessed. She paired it with a black patched bomber jacket, denim bottoms and put her hair up to give her shirt the limelight. This outfit will be super easy to recreate with pieces you already have in your closet.

6. Pair It With A Cool Print
Fashion editor and stylist Giovanna Battaglia pairs her t-shirt with statement leopard pants, metallic heels and her signature heart-shaped shades. She proves that the basic tee is versatile enough to be paired with crazy prints.
7. Wear It Warm
British fashion blogger Susanna Lau’s take on the basic tee is great for cooler days (which, we’re experiencing now). She layered a t-shirt over her striped turtle-neck top for a cosy, yet stylish get-up.
8. Keep It Casual
If sticking to basics is your thing, take this outfit from trend watcher and online influencer Linda Tol as your inspiration. We love how she wears her oversized Balenciaga T-shirt tucked into high-waist denim jeans, to make the outfit more body flattering and pulls the outfit together with a chic and classic red lip.
